| Cybersecurity Analyst (Secondary Keywords: Threat Intelligence, Vulnerability Management) |
Identify and mitigate cyber threats, ensuring the security of smart systems. |
| Security Architect (Secondary Keywords: Cloud Security, Network Security) |
Design and implement secure architectures for smart city infrastructure and IoT devices. |
| Penetration Tester (Secondary Keywords: Ethical Hacking, Security Auditing) |
Identify vulnerabilities in smart security systems through ethical hacking techniques. |
| Security Engineer (Secondary Keywords: System Administration, Incident Response) |
Develop and maintain secure systems, responding to security incidents effectively. |
